Add rowscolumns and edit fields easily with the intuitive user interface. You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. To modify data in the existing records the following commands can be used. But when i open or browser through data session menu in foxpro 6 i still see the data from the test table. In a foxpro program, when you issue the select tablename command. Is it possible to know how many records are there in my table which are not deleted. Visual foxpro is a discontinued microsoft datacentric procedural programming language that subsequently became objectoriented it was derived from foxpro originally known as foxbase which was developed by fox software beginning in 1984. Foxpro does not have direct support for a limit clause. Pdb is not a selfexplaining datafile extension in a visual foxpro context. When visual foxpro creates an index, the index expression is saved in the index file but only a reference to the userdefined function is included in the index expression. We would like to show you a description here but the site wont allow us. Foxpro 2 6 software free download foxpro 2 6 top 4 download offers free software downloads for windows, mac, ios and android computers and mobile devices.
If you need some additional commands, we can discuss it at our forum. Returns the record number of the selected record in the active browse window. The reason that your recno s are not showing the correct values is that you cannot make any assumptions about the internal workings of the select command, including the order in which it sees its input records. Hello, i have a foxpro 6, where i need to delete all the rows from test. Vfp basic data concepts wiki for microsoft visual foxpro development. Some products will also include a link to the list of factory sounds that were included on when purchased new. What is the equivalent to vfps recno as used in a query. Solved how to fix corrupted visual foxpro 9 dbf, dbc. Mar 22, 2015 3visual foxpro options set in the registry and their actual values 4wmi script run from visual foxpro 5writing in registry 6returning all the vfp registered olecontrols from the registry 7associated applications with files extension. Find answers to update statement in foxpro from the expert community at experts exchange. This software is a simple gui tool which uses openssl command line utility underneath. The current version of visual foxpro is combased and microsoft has stated that they do not intend to create a microsoft. Learn how to build a data access layer to communicate with either dbfs or sql server.
When you choose menu commands, visual foxpro language commands are echoed in the command window. Returns the current system date, which is controlled by the operating system. Jun 21, 2012 i am not denying the foxpro uses a sql dialect, as does ms access and oracle, but none of them are compatible as this thread clearly proves see pcelba comment here. In foxpro for msdos, you can open the ascii chart desk accessory for a list of characters and their. Cindy winegarden mcsd, microsoft visual foxpro mvp. Yes, it differs from tsql, but you may have replace and such foxpro specific commands in mind. It shows the screen active database file, the current record pointer position, number of records in the database file. I use the following strapline command to create a query.
The application is very nicely designed and has a graphical interface that users of all levels should have no difficulties understanding. You can convert foxpro to ms sql or ms sql to foxpro simply by configuring several options through wizard interface or in command line mode. Delete text by pressing esc if you havent already pressed enter to execute the command. The xbase function recno tells me which record the pointer is on. Unsupported visual foxpro commands and functions visual foxpro odbc driver 01192017. It designed to sign any type of files with gost algorithm gost cipher and will be especially useful for russian isps and it companies which in one way or another have to deal with roskomnadzors forbidden sites list to reduce the timewaste while typing in. If seek finds a record with a matching index key, recno returns the record number of the matching record, found returns true. Development continued under the visual foxpro label, which in turn was discontinued in 2007. Foxpro commands overview append, set, record, go to, skip. Here is brief overview and example usage of the basic foxpro. Saving and restoring settings in vfp applications sweetpotato. However, the file format is supported in other database and databaserelated applications too.
Computer software can be put into categories based on common function, type, or field of use. This application is provided for users of microsoft windows xp, vista, 7, 8, 8. Unsupported visual foxpro commands and functions sql server. If you use a userdefined function in an index expression, visual foxpro must be able to locate the userdefined function. Foxpro is a textbased procedurally oriented programming language and database management system dbms, and it is also an objectoriented programming language, originally published by fox software and later by microsoft, for msdos, windows, macintosh, and unix.
Select command and table record position microsoft. You can connect to foxpro via a dbc file or multiple dbf files in a folder. Foxpro has always featured an extensible development environment, and has always relied on xbase components, ever since genmenu. If you add next 4 to the scan command above, the total number of iterations is four, not four for each table. The sound programming utility is an easytouse application that assists you in managing the sounds in your foxpro game call. How to locate a value or closest match in a visual foxpro. Even cooler, youll do it with no code to change when you move from dbfs to sql tables, and an upsizing wizard to migrate the data for you. Since my data are huge i want to retrieve few rows at a time using row number. You could do a conditional breakpoint on the condition recno tablea changes, keep it inactive, suspend right before the sql, turn on the breakpoint and then resume. Find out how to use a data access layer in foxpro, which gives you the ability to use dbfs, sql server, a webconnection xml server, or xml web services. Is there other way to do this without using store procedure but oledb. How to print a general field by using word and visual foxpro 9. Foxpro is a textbased procedurally oriented programming language and dbms, and it is also an objectoriented software programming language, originally published by fox software and later by microsoft, for msdos, windows, macintosh, and unix.
Even a simple dos operating system with 16 mb ram can process foxpro 2. Wo alias depends not only on the join type but on the order of joins applied this is sort of related with each other. If youre using a foxpro foundation class buttonset then there most likely will be code in the parent class. Nov 30, 2006 lists out all the records of the currently opened dbf without recno. I noticed after i switched to vfp9 that when i use a table from the ide command window, the record number and record count dont appear at the bottom of the scr vfp9 not displaying recno reccount in tooltip bar microsoft. There are two columns named a and b in each dbf, a is a series of number and b is vlookup, and i want to replace the columnb in february with new if its values in columna do not appear in. Ive seen lots of foxpro programs that use go top before a scan loop and select. This software offers a solution to users who want to make changes to data in foxpro tables. Including recno in a querys field list can be tricky, though. Explain function of foxpro command recall,pack,replace.
Advance foxpro commands software free download advance. The bug fix list for sp2 can be viewed or downloaded from this page. Youll note that when i instantiate the class i send it the command that im about to. Returns 1 if file deleted, 0 if not found function deletefile lparameter m.
Recno cname nage 1 rick 34 2 dan 30 3 chris 33 an index is a logical reorganization of the data in a table. The vfp set near command controls what happens to the record pointer in a vfp table after an unsuccessful seek or find operation seek uses an index on a vfp column to locate a value. Working with the registry in visual foxpro visual foxpro. Foxpro at its heart, is not a setbased language like sql. Often in code visual foxpro developers will find themselves having to save the. Unsupported visual foxpro commands and functions sql. Foxpro commands overview append, set, record, go to. Foxpro database software software free download foxpro. Foxpro table files use the dbf file extension too, in the database software called microsoft visual foxpro. This version of the setup wizard is only for use with visual foxpro 6. I dont know what data file type you are using vfp table, mssql. Building a visual foxpro application for sql server why. This software offers a solution to users who want to transfer tables and queries between their ms access and foxpro databases.
When near is on, the record pointer in the vfp table is positioned at the closest matching record after an unsuccessful seek. You can save data to sql dump file to get over any restrictions on access to ms sql server or generate program files.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Does showing the record number offer your users any information other than showing them they have actually moved to another record. For the editing of data in your foxpro tables, foxpro editor software is the tool to have. Bat file, or by the windows scheduler below are listed the commands, with their syntax and parameters. Foxpro, originally from fox software and later microsoft, is a relational database that clones the functionality of dbase iv, but offers vast speed improvements. Download service pack 2 for microsoft visual foxpro 9. Working with the registry in visual foxpro visual foxpro codes. Recno returns negative numbers for records appended in a table buffer.
Data access in visual foxpro before visual foxpro 8. Jul 08, 2010 dot used after macro substitution means end of macro and does not appear in the final command, so you should use double dots. Returns the record number of the current work area. It goes that one of the first things you will have to do is select the foxpro database you wish to connect to. Set status on displays status bar at the bottom of the screen. I cannot give you one command to do this, but it is relatively easy if you use a small program. Turn the camera to the on position, press the mode button, then press the up arrow once to software upgrade, press the enter button and change the option from no to yes, finally press the enter button when on yes. Recno returns a value that is one greater than the number of records in the table if the record pointer is positioned beyond the last record in the table. When i write long programs, i like to know what they are doing and how soon i. In general, it is advisable not to use functions in select that depend on the sequence of the records in the input tables. Just dont use it on a database that has a memo field. Solving common problems with vfps sql tomorrows solutions. The command window is a visual foxpro system window.
Dbf commander professional lets you handle dbf files via the command line interface thus, you can run it in msdos mode with defined parameters, or in batch mode by using a. Here is a table that i will refer to during my answer. Track users it needs, easily, and with only the features you need. There are two columns named a and b in each dbf, a is a series of number and b is vlookup, and i want to replace the columnb in february with new if its values in columna do not appear in the column a in january, and old for vice versa.
You can also type visual foxpro commands directly into the command window. Visual foxpros sql language lets you solve a variety of problems in database. Im trying to write a sql statement that generates sequential invoice numbers, for example, inv99001, inv99002, so really the databases record number may not be the best solution as it might. So placing a foxpro sql question in the ms sql server zone is clearly inappropriate. This command lists item name with price rupees 20 added.
How do i use a variable as a database name in foxpro 2. One among other options could be that your pdb is just a renamed dbf table file, so that your existing code could for example use foxpro s use command in order to open the file. Recno returns a value 1 greater than the number of records in the table and eof returns true. Visual foxpro generates an error message if you issue go recno0 when a close match isnt found. The dbase system includes the core database engine, a query system, a forms engine, and a programming language that ties all of these components together. Jan 17, 2016 how to fix corrupted visual foxpro 9 dbf, dbc. I know in foxpro recno would be the record number of the row. Foxpro replace with for in foxpro how to build software. Avoid using recno in the index expression for a table. The foxpro manual and product documentation section contains manuals and other writeups for all current and discontinued products. But as an exercise just to see if i could get it to work, i wrote a couple of functions that could be used to return a specific record based on the physical.
This product download contains updated visual foxpro 6. And as he also pointed out, the rowid is also a good choice you could include the rowid in the original select statement. If you work in a mixed environment, where some of your tools read and write visual foxpro tables and others only read and write the older style fox2x dbase iii, this function will work wonderfully for you. You can use seek only with indexed tables, and you can search only on the index key. What happens when you nave deleted records in your table. The changes are applied only to the view, it not saved in database.
When i tried, delete from test it works, i test with select statement. Print a general field using word and visual foxpro 9. An extra command was added to the shortcut so foxpro would immediately start my app, something like. This software will generate the necessary sql commands for importing and exporting for you. Under windows xp i used to launch my foxpro application through a desktop shortcut. Update statement in foxpro solutions experts exchange. Hence, the single table is called as database in this tutorial in foxpro, first four characters of any command is enough to execute for e. To expand on eyvinds answer i would create a program to uses the recno function to pull records within a given range, say. Browse other questions tagged visualfoxpro or ask your own question. When using the report designer to print a general field that has text inserted into it with a word processor, the ole bound control object of the report designer has to be sized to be as large as the largest amount of text in the general fields. The match must be exact unless set exact is set to off. Rather, its a specialized language focusing on data operations, using the dbf format.
Sp2 provides the latest updates to visual foxpro 9. When there are joins do not use recno with or wo alias. And one more thing to do is use coverage logging to log any code happening, this can even be done in an exe on a pc just having vfp runtimes available. For operations where you dont want to deal with entire sets, and for some reason are still programming in foxpro, you can most easily accomplish this by embracing the xbase roots and running with it.
273 425 942 1390 145 1484 856 342 1560 38 1027 383 742 1193 496 335 1418 1214 1381 1207 768 160 186 1588 873 72 1567 906 462 939 422 1250 875 722 936 1002